Chu is a scholar working on Control and Systems Engineering, Biomedical Engineering and Nuclear and High Energy Physics.
According to data from OpenAlex, Chu has authored 74 papers receiving a total of 336 indexed citations (citations by other indexed papers that have themselves been cited), including 18 papers in Control and Systems Engineering, 12 papers in Biomedical Engineering and 8 papers in Nuclear and High Energy Physics. Recurrent topics in Chu's work include Magnetic confinement fusion research (7 papers), Stability and Control of Uncertain Systems (7 papers) and Superconducting Materials and Applications (5 papers). Chu is often cited by papers focused on Magnetic confinement fusion research (7 papers), Stability and Control of Uncertain Systems (7 papers) and Superconducting Materials and Applications (5 papers). Chu collaborates with scholars based in Australia and United Kingdom. Chu's co-authors include Jian JIAN, Anna Koumarianou, Su, Wu, Aaron Harwood, Peter J. Stuckey, Ji, Li, Lijuan and Wang and has published in prestigious journals such as British Journal of Dermatology, PubMed and OSTI OAI (U.S. Department of Energy Office of Scientific and Technical Information).
